This journal is mine to use in any way I want. I can get creative, use quotes and pictures, paint and draw. I want to make it unique and a place I'm happy to visit as I keep track of what I've eaten , calories, exercise, thoughts on moods and feelings, etc.
I've broken my journal broken down into sections.
*Section one includes my diet/meal plan, goals for calories, exercise and weight; with goals broken down into long term and short term.
*Section two is my tracking area with daily food, exercise and weight logs.
*Section three is my daily goal sheets that include my meal plan, a diary section for my thoughts and feelings, and a gratitude section. download daily diary
*Section four is a photo journal of myself that I've taken along the journey that includes measurements.
